> > On Wed, 2004-04-14 at 14:28, Clifford Snow wrote:
> > > I'm attempting to change the hostname of my box. I used the following
> > > steps to change the hostname:
> > > 1. Edited /etc/sysconfig/network to change the
> > > HOSTNAME=newname.example.com
> > > 2. Edited /etc/hosts to 127.0.0.1 localhost.localdomain localhost
> > > newname
> > > 3. Ran /bin/hostname newname
> > >
> > > I seem to be missing something because opening a web browser just
> > > hangs. What other places need to be changed to change the hostname?
> >
> > You forgot step 0: xhost +localhost. The X server is no longer able to
> > send it's information to the original host name (since you changed it).
> > Restart X (Ctrl+Alt+Backspace) and you should be able to start a
> > browser.
>
> And also be consistant with the hostname (in the above 3 steps)
>
> HOSTNAME=newname
True, and the OP didn't mention that (s)he restarted the network (step
2.5) ;o)
